Which bank is better Chase or Wells Fargo?
Both banks offer several business checking accounts but Wells Fargo is the clear winner due to its lower monthly fees and higher transaction limits. The main drawback we see with Wells Fargo are the low APYs—if you're looking to earn money through interest, this is not the bank for you. Wells Fargo should also be avoided by people who struggle with overdraft fees. The standard overdraft fee is $35 at a max of three a day.What is the problem with Wells Fargo?
The Wells Fargo account fraud scandal is a controversy brought about by the creation of millions of fraudulent savings and checking accounts on behalf of Wells Fargo clients without their consent. Everyday Checking fees and detailsYou can avoid the $10 monthly service fee with one of the following each fee period: $500 minimum daily balance. $500 or more in total qualifying direct deposits. The primary account owner is 17 - 24 years old.
